In 2017 we were honoured to work with the Queen Mary Hospital in celebation of its 80th Anniversary. We created a Tree of Love in a corner of the hospital in connection with its Organ Donation Programme. This corner will be a quiet place where donor recipients and families can sit and reflect on the love, hope and joy that organ donation brings. We held a workshop where hospital staff and organ donors and recipients painted watercolour butterflies which were mounted onto the tree at the Opening Ceremony on 18th November 2017.
